Transaction 58a4ce5d5ae6f07f660d6448e0a17d898cdc8fc82a8b86601e2b9501015ab116

1 Input
2 Outputs
  • 58a4ce5d5ae6f07f660d6448e0a17d898cdc8fc82a8b86601e2b9501015ab116:0
  • value  4529000
    address  1HrhNpsgizXqAbUcUXvotKZuYWtWgpLhtv
  • 58a4ce5d5ae6f07f660d6448e0a17d898cdc8fc82a8b86601e2b9501015ab116:1
  • value  758632848
    address  16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i